Q: Is 586,796 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 586,796 is a composite number.

Why is 586,796 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 586,796 can be evenly divided by 1 2 4 7 14 19 28 38 76 133 266 532 1,103 2,206 4,412 7,721 15,442 20,957 30,884 41,914 83,828 146,699 293,398 and 586,796, with no remainder.

Since 586,796 cannot be divided by just 1 and 586,796, it is a composite number.
